How to prepare for a job interview at Compass Group
✨Showcase Your Culinary Passion
During the interview, make sure to express your enthusiasm for food and cooking. Share specific examples of innovative dishes you've created or unique culinary experiences that highlight your passion and creativity in the kitchen.
✨Demonstrate Leadership Skills
As a Head Chef, you'll be leading a team. Be prepared to discuss your management style and provide examples of how you've successfully motivated and inspired your team in previous roles. Highlight any experience you have in training staff and fostering a positive work environment.
✨Understand Food Safety Regulations
Familiarise yourself with food safety standards, HSE, and COSHH regulations. Be ready to discuss how you ensure compliance in your kitchen and share any relevant experiences where you implemented successful food safety practices.
✨Discuss Budget Management
Since the role involves monitoring costs and budgeting, come prepared to talk about your experience with food costing and financial management. Provide examples of how you've effectively managed budgets in the past and any strategies you've used to reduce waste and increase profitability.
